The Asian Scientist 100
Long Ran
Institution
University of Science and Technology of China
Country
China
Field
Chemistry
Long won the 2017 L’Oréal UNESCO For Women in Science International Rising Talent award for her research on photocatalysts for carbon dioxide reduction.
